|
在现代网络通信和应用程序开发中,代码签名证书扮演着至关重要的角色。通过对代码进行签名,开发者可以证明代码的真实性和完整性,确保用户可以安全地下载和运行应用程序。然而,很多人可能会对代码签名证书的有效期有所疑惑,究竟代码签名证书的有效期是否存在时间限制呢?
在实际操作中,代码签名证书的有效期是存在时间限制的。通常情况下,代码签名证书的有效期为1年。一旦证书过期,开发者就需要重新申请新的代码签名证书来继续对代码进行签名。这种设计是为了保证代码的安全性和可靠性,防止过去的代码被滥用或者篡改。
代码签名证书的有效期限制对于软件开发者来说是一个双刃剑。一方面,有效期限制能够促使开发者及时更新代码签名证书,避免过期证书对应用程序的安全性产生隐患。另一方面,频繁地更新代码签名证书也给开发者带来了额外的工作量和费用。因此,开发者需要在有效期临近时及时更新代码签名证书,以确保应用程序的正常运行和用户的安全。
除了时间限制之外,代码签名证书的有效性还取决于证书的颁发机构和证书的认可范围。通常情况下,由权威的数字证书颁发机构颁发的代码签名证书将会受到更广泛的认可,其有效性也更有保障。而一些自签名证书或者低信任度的证书可能会受到一些安全软件的拦截,导致应用程序无法正常运行。
综上所述,代码签名证书的有效期虽然存在时间限制,但是这种限制是为了保证代码的安全性和可靠性。开发者需要在证书有效期临近时及时更新证书,以确保应用程序能够正常运行并获得用户的信任。同时,选择权威的数字证书颁发机构颁发的代码签名证书也是非常重要的,可以提高应用程序的可信度和安全性。
总的来说,代码签名证书的有效期虽然有限制,但是这种限制是为了保护应用程序和用户的安全。开发者需要认真对待代码签名证书的有效期,及时更新证书,确保应用程序的正常运行和安全性。通过合理有效地管理代码签名证书,我们能够构建更加安全可靠的应用程序,为用户提供更好的体验。
|
|